Railroad employees are entitled to payment for injuries and health problems sustained due to their job. Workers struggling with railroad settlement asthma may pursue legal action under the Federal Employers Liability Act (FELA), which provides a structure for employees to seek damages for injuries triggered by carelessness. The following are the common steps included:

Documentation of Injury: Collect comprehensive medical records and paperwork that support the asthma medical diagnosis and link it to work-related exposures.

Alert Employer: Inform the company about the asthma condition and its possible relation to work settings to start an internal examination.

Speak with an Attorney: Seek legal suggestions from a lawyer experienced in FELA claims and occupational hazards.

Submitting a Claim: If wanted, file an official claim against the railroad company, providing evidence of neglect or risky working conditions.

Settlement Negotiation: Enter negotiations with the railroad business for a settlement that covers medical expenses, lost incomes, and future care.

Pursue Court Action: If a satisfying settlement can not be reached, the plaintiff has the option to take the case to court.
Assistance Systems for Asthma Patients
For individuals affected by railroad settlement asthma, a number of support group help with diagnosis and treatment. These include:

Occupational Health Services: Railroad companies often offer access to occupational health centers focusing on detecting and handling work-related illnesses.

Pulmonary Rehabilitation Programs: These programs assist patients enhance their lung health through exercise and education on asthma management techniques.

Medication: Prescription medications, such as inhalers and corticosteroids, can considerably minimize asthma symptoms and enhance quality of life.

Assistance Groups: Joining regional or online asthma assistance groups can supply emotional support and shared experiences for those dealing with comparable challenges.
